Output 27906edf7091ad0e2b3bbba240b9e79ce11c3529e699fdcab77396eb7cd0d55b:30

value
2502538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 630ab9419d9e49e3a553eb7eb834c061803937a8 OP_EQUAL
address
3AihfdMzuv9xr18JbHiYBLfWjnPFSQRQpT
transaction
27906edf7091ad0e2b3bbba240b9e79ce11c3529e699fdcab77396eb7cd0d55b
spent
true